The Goblin Mage in D&D: Tactics and Roleplaying
The scrawny Goblin wizard presents a unique challenge and reward in Dungeons & Dragons. Disregard the stereotype of a weak combatant; these intelligent spellcasters utilize cunning and battlefield positioning to outwit larger enemies. A Goblin practitioner excels at long attacks, frequently employing limited illusion spells to disorient adversaries, followed by a well-placed blast of energy. Roleplaying a Goblin conjuror demands embracing their inherent greed and impish nature; consider them a shrewd opportunist always pursuing an edge, potentially undermining allies for a individual gain. Understanding their quirks elevates the Goblin magic wielder from a common character into a memorable addition to any team.
